Top 10 richest Go professionals in 2008 world Go arena: Cho U 9p of Japan ranks #1 with total winning prize of about $1.28 million; #2, Lee Sedol about $711 thousands; #3, Yamashita Keigo about $685 thousands; #4, Gu Li about $566 thousands; #5, Takao Shinji about $505 thousands; #6, Hane Naoki about $504 thousands; #7, Kono Rin about $463 thousands; #8, Cho Chikun about $416 thousands; #9, Iyama Yuta about $369 thousands; #10, Lee Changho about $226 thousands.2009-01-05

In the semi final of the 7th Chunlan Cup held on 12/11, Lee Changho 9p defeated Kong Jie 7p by resignation and Chang Hao 9p knocked out teammate Zhou Heyang 9p by resignation. Therefore Lee Changho and Chang Hao will meet again in the final of world major Go tournaments. The final will be held in May or June next year.2008-12-11 View

The final game 3 of the 34th Tengen Title was held on 12/4, the challenger Cho U 9p defeated Kono Rin 9p by resignation, therefore Cho U obtains the title by winning three straight games and total score of 3:0. This is also Cho U's third title after Meijin Title and Gosei.2008-12-04
The best-of-5 title match of the 36th Korean Myungin started to play on 12/1. In the game 1, Kang Doonyoon 8p defeated Lee Sedol 9p by 5.5 points with a big comeback after trailing 20 points at one point. This is also the second game of the 10-game series between Kang Doonyoon and Lee Sedol. On 11/10, Kang Doonyoon defeated Lee Sedol by resignation in the first game of the 13th Chunwon Title best-of-5 series. So far, Kang Doonyoon takes 2:0 lead in their 10-game series, the second game of 13th Chunwon Title will take place on 12/5.2008-12-01 View

In the decisive game 5 of the 21st Chinese Mingren Title best-of-5 final held on 11/20, Gu Li 9p defeated the challenger Piao Wenyao 5p by resignation, successfully completed the great comeback and defended his title by 3:2 after losing the first two games in the series. This is also Gu Li's fifth straight Mingren Title.2008-11-20 View
